How Does Invisalign Work?
Invisalign's secret sauce is a series of custom-made, clear plastic aligners. These aligners gradually shift your teeth into their optimal position over time. You wear each set for approximately 1-2 weeks before replacing them with the next set in the series, pushing your teeth further along their journey. Most individuals require between 18-30 sets of aligners throughout their Invisalign treatment.

Invisalign Aligner Adjustment Techniques
Invisalign trays can be adjusted through several methods, such as:
- Reshaping: Carefully reshaping certain areas of the aligners to create more space or lessen pressure on specific teeth
- Composite Attachments: Adding small tooth-colored composite attachments to your teeth for an enhanced aligner grip and better teeth control
- Interarch Elastics: Hooking interarch elastics onto attachments or buttons on your aligners to help particular teeth shift into position
- Filling Gaps: Filling gaps between teeth with the same material used to make the aligners to ensure a snug fit
- Replacing Attachments: If an attachment falls off a tooth, we can replace it for the aligner to effectively grip and move that tooth again
The Invisalign Adjustment Process Gone Simple
Getting your Invisalign aligners adjusted is a breeze! No new impressions or lengthy waits for new aligners.
- Step 1: Visit us and identify the problem areas concerning aligner fit or comfort. We'll examine your teeth and document any movement issues.
- Step 2: Depending on the needed adjustments, we'll make modifications on the spot, re-shaping, adding composites, elastics, replacing attachments, et cetera to enhance the aligner fit.
- Step 3: You get to keep wearing the aligners you currently have with the adjustments made. Most adjustments offer immediate relief.
- Step 4: Carry on with changing to your next aligner according to schedule unless told otherwise.
There's usually no recovery period required. Simplify your day by popping your aligners back in!

Q1. How long do adjustments take?
A1. Most Invisalign aligner adjustments can be completed during regular appointment time. The duration can range from 15-30 minutes, depending on what adjustments are needed. No need to wait weeks for new aligners.
Q2. Can adjustments fix my Invisalign treatment if progress stalls?
A2. Yes, adjustments can help get your teeth moving again if progress stalls, ensuring you stay on schedule. Reshaping and elastics can provide the necessary push.
Q3. Does tweaking the aligners hurt?
A3. No pain at all! Just improved comfort and fit.
Q4. How often can aligners be adjusted?
A4. Adjustments can be made as often as needed throughout treatment. Some patients might require one or two tweaks, while others may need more, depending on tooth movement.
Q5. Do adjustments impact treatment length or outcome?
A5. No, adjustments are made to improve aligner performance and timing, allowing treatment to stay on track.
Q6. Can I adjust the trays myself?
A6. No, it's essential to leave all adjustments to professionals to avoid damaging the trays and affecting treatment progress.
